Celebrating the first day of the month of May began as an ancient
Northern Hemisphere spring festival. It is usually a public holiday
and also a traditional holiday in many cultures. The celebration of
May Day coincides with International Workers’ Day in countries
with May Day festivities that include dancing and singing. .

TV HOST BORN ON THIS DAY IN 1918
Jack Harold Paar (May 1, 1918 – January 27, 2004)
Jack Paar hosted The Tonight Show on NBC from 1957
to 1962. He paved the way for Johnny Carson and others
before leaving television while still in his prime.
